    Content: This book establishes several weak limit laws for problems in geometric extreme value theory. We find the limit law of the maximum Euclidean distance of i.i.d. points, as the number of points tends to infinity, under certain assumptions on the underlying distribution. One of the methods is also applicable for some other functionals, such as the maximum area or the maximum perimeter of triangles formed by point triplets.
